Net Prices definition

Net Prices means the value per security of the securities on offer or bid excluding commission and any other charges.

Net Prices. If in arriving at the contract amount the contractor shall have added to or deducted from the total of the items in the Tender any sum, either as a percentage or otherwise, then the net price of any item in the Tender shall be the sum arrived at by adding to or deducting from the actual figure appearing in the Tender as the price of that item a similar percentage of proportionate sum, provided always that in determining the percentage or proportion of the sum so added or deducted by the contractor the total amount of any Prime Cost Items and Provisional sum of money shall be deducted from the total amount of the Tender. The expression "net rates" or "net prices" when used with reference to the contract or accounts shall be held to mean rates or prices so arrived at.   • Net Price as defined in Section 2, Definitions, of Attachment 2, Scope of Work, is hereby deleted in its entirety and replaced with the following: Net Price - The final price paid by the Customer after applying all MSRP discounts and MSRP Credits. The Net Price for Base Equipment, OEM and Non-OEM Option(s), Part(s), Accessory(ies), and Implement(s); and their respective features, equipment, and components shall include all charges for the Commodity, including but not limited to packing, handling, freight, distribution, transportation, startup, pre-delivery, delivery, inspection, installation, construction, assembly, title, and registration. The Contractor may include shipping charges for OEM and Non-OEM Options, Parts, Accessories, and Implements that the customer orders separately from the Base Equipment. Additional charges for a Commodity shall not be charged outside of the Net Price unless expressly authorized within the Scope of Work.

  • Market prices means current prices that are established in the course of ordinary trade between buyers and sellers free to bargain and that can be substantiated through competition or from sources independent of the offerors.

  • Current Prices means the prices for the specified materials prevailing on any date subsequent to the date 28 days prior to the latest date set for the submission of the Tenders, by reason of any National or State Statute or Ordinance,

  • Basic Prices means the prices for the specified materials prevailing on the date 28 days prior to the latest date for submission of Tenders.
